Note generali

Sometimes attributed to Jean Leurechon.

A translation of: Récréation mathématicque.

The translation is sometimes attributed to Francis Malthus or, wrongly, to William Oughtred.

With an additional title page, engraved, preceded by a letterpress explanation, and a final license leaf.

Identified as STC 15530 on UMI microfilm.
